Fechner's legacy in psychology : 150 years of elementary psychophysics / / edited by Joshua A. Solomon.

This collection celebrates the 150th anniversary of Fechner's book on Psychophysics (originally published ten years after his epiphany of Oct. 22, 1850). Topics include modern assessments of the problems with which Fechner wrestled. Also included are more general discussions of psychophysical m...
